Kochi University of Technology (KUT), established in 1997, was originally a private university. Founded by the Kochi prefectural government, KUT ambitiously set its sights in becoming a world-class university through the pursuit of unique excellence. KUT’s revolutionary design, introducing innovations contributed greatly to development in university education. Despite its relatively small scale, KUT has had a strong presence with its distinctive character and progressive education system. Notably, KUT took the lead in adopting a quarter system to enable intensive learning. Valuing student autonomy, KUT has no compulsory courses.

Central European University (CEU) was founded in 1991 with a mission to educating free minds for a free society. Today more than 16,000 alumni carry the values —respect for knowledge and critical inquiry—into responsible positions in government, business, civil society, academic life and politics around the world. As one of the world’s most influential social sciences universities, the University has attained global recognition for teaching and research. And with students, faculty, and staff from well over a hundred countries, CEU is one of the most diverse, open and pluralistic academic communities in the world.

Tohoku University was established as Japan’s third national university in 1907. Located on the ancient site of Aoba Castle in Sendai City, Tohoku University is proud to be ranked among Japan’s leading universities. Since its establishment, Tohoku University has established itself as an academic leader, producing a number of achievements under the spirit of Research First, the philosophy of Open Doors and the policy of Practice-Oriented Research and Education.

The Oxford Centre for Islamic Studies is a Recognized Independent Centre of the University of Oxford. It was established in 1985 to encourage the scholarly study of Islam and the Islamic world. The Centre provides a meeting point for the Western and Islamic worlds of learning. At Oxford, it contributes to the multi-disciplinary and cross-disciplinary study of the Islamic world. Beyond Oxford, its role is strengthened by an international network of academic contacts. For more information, please refer to the Oxford Centre for Islamic Studies website.

The purpose of the OCIS PG Scholarships is to encourage and assist student to undertake studies that will be of benefit to the Muslim world. Scholarship will be awarded on the basis of academic merit. For those candidates ordinarily resident in the UK and from a Muslim community, a preference will be given to those from a financially disadvantaged background. Applicants must be able to show how their intended course of study is of relevance and or benefit to the Muslim world.

Osaka University was founded in 1931 as the sixth imperial university of Japan through strong demand from the business and government sectors of Osaka, as well as the people of Osaka City and Prefecture. The roots of Osaka University can be found in Kaitokudo and Tekijuku of the Edo period. The academic culture and spirit of these two places of scholarship are inherited even today, and the spirit of innovation and a restless spirit of challenge serve as the cornerstone for our endeavors in education and research. Under the motto “Live Locally, Grow Globally,” Osaka University grapples with the challenges of education and research. And after a huge undertaking merging Osaka University with Osaka University of Foreign Studies in 2007, the university has shown that it will continue to develop as one of Japan’s leading comprehensive research universities.

The University of Tokyo is a world-class platform for research and education, contributing to human knowledge in partnership with other leading global universities. The University of Tokyo aims to nurture global leaders with a strong sense of public responsibility and a pioneering spirit, possessing both deep specialism and broad knowledge. The University of Tokyo aims to expand the boundaries of human knowledge in partnership with society. Details about how the University is carrying out this mission can be found in the University of Tokyo Charter and the Action Plans.

Currently, the University of Tokyo is comprised of 10 Faculties, 15 Graduate Schools, 11 affiliated research institutes (including the Research Center for Advanced Science and Technology), 13 University-wide centers, three affiliated libraries and two institutes for advanced study. Furthermore, the Faculties, Graduate Schools and research institutes have facilities associated with them; for instance, the University of Tokyo Hospital is one such facility. In addition to the three main campuses in Hongo, Komaba and Kashiwa, facilities affiliated with the University of Tokyo are spread all throughout Japan.

Kyushu University is one of the public universities in Japan, located in Fukuoka, on the island of Kyushu. It is the 4th oldest university in Japan and one of the former Imperial Universities. It is considered as one of the most prestigious research-oriented universities in Japan. The history of Kyushu University can be traced back to the medical schools of the Fukuoka feudal domain established in 1867. More than 28,000 students study at the university, of which more than 1,800 students are international. The university is ranked among the top 200 in the world.

The Okazaki Kaheita International Scholarship Foundation (The Foundation) was established in March 1990 to contribute to world peace and development by fostering people from the People’s Republic of China and other countries in Asia. This foundation strives to promote mutual understanding and international exchange as well as to pay homage to and immortalize the spirit of Okazaki Kaheita, a man who worked for mutual understanding, peace, and world friendship.

In order to promote friendship between Japan and Asian countries and to further the personal development of people in these countries, the foundation provides scholarships to students from Asian countries who wish to study in graduate schools in Japan.

The China-AUN Scholarship is a full scholarship established by the Ministry of Education, People’s Republic of China, to sponsor students, teachers, and scholars from ASEAN nations to study in China and to enhance the academic exchange and mutual understanding between China and ASEAN members.  For the academic year 2020/2021, there are 30 scholarships available.

Eligibility

  • Applicants must be a citizen of an ASEAN member country (Brunei, Cambodia, Indonesia, Laos, Malaysia, Myanmar, Philippines, Singapore, Thailand, and Vietnam), and be in good health
  • The requirements for applicants’ degree and age:
    • be a bachelor’s degree holder under the age of 35 when applying for the master’s program.
    • be a master’s degree holder under the age of 40 when applying for the doctoral programs.

Scholarship 
Tuition waiver, accommodation, stipend, and comprehensive medical insurance.

The Graduate Institute Geneva (IHEID) was created in 1927 at the time of the League of Nations. It was then the first academic institution in the world entirely devoted to the study of international affairs. Its vocation is to analyze and stimulate critical thinking in the fields of international relations and development issues through its teaching (master and Ph.D. programs), research, executive education, and public events.

The Institute fosters interdisciplinary dialogue, drawing on the main social science disciplines (anthropology, development economics, international economics, international history, international relations, political science, and sociology), as well as international law. Intellectual excellence is at the heart of the Institute’s mission, driven by the conviction that only rigorous inquiry and critical thinking can provide concrete solutions to the world’s challenges. The Institute’s commitment to critical inquiry goes hand-in-hand with its dedication to international cooperation and human solidarity.
